Small Business Administration Honors Centennial with Dwight D. Eisenhower Award

RESTON, Va. — Centennial Contractors Enterprises was recently awarded the Dwight D. Eisenhower Award for Excellence in Construction by the U.S. Small Business Administration. The award recognizes large prime contractors who have excelled in utilization of small businesses as suppliers and subcontractors.

Centennial, a national contractor with offices throughout the United States, is an industry leader in Job Order Contracting. It actively conducts outreach to enhance the skill levels of small businesses so they can compete for significant work.

“Our small business partners are essential to achieving our objectives and continue to demonstrate daily the fantastic entrepreneurial spirit of this country,” said Brent LeVander, western regional vice president. “We work with our small-business partners to create quality services and solutions to satisfy our customers" needs with the added benefit of supporting the broader growth and prosperity of small businesses in the local community. Active collaboration and partnering with small business is a requirement for all of us.”

SBA Administrator Karen Mills recently presented the award to Centennial during the official National Small Business Week award ceremony in Washington, D.C. National Small Business Week recognizes outstanding small business owners and advocates for achievements and contributions to the nation's economic and social vitality.
